Credit Card Sales

Transactions where customers use credit cards to pay for goods or services, resulting in receivables for the seller.

Periodically Recorded

Financial transactions or events that are recorded at regular intervals, such as monthly, quarterly, or annually.

Bank Credit Cards

Financial instruments issued by banks that allow cardholders to borrow funds with which to pay for goods and services, subject to the agreement that the funds will be repaid.
